
International Women's Peace Service
The International Women's Peace Service (IWPS) is a voluntary organization dedicated to promoting peace and human rights, primarily through on-the-ground presence in conflict zones. It mobilizes women to resist violence, document human rights abuses, and support affected communities. IWPS aims to empower women as agents of change, foster nonviolent solutions, and advocate for justice, often working in regions experiencing ongoing conflicts or military occupation. By combining grassroots activism and international solidarity, IWPS strives to build peace and protect vulnerable populations through dedicated, community-based efforts.
